Position Overview

We are seeking a Strategic Account Manager - Rail to drive growth and strengthen relationships across the rail sector in Ireland. This role is ideal for someone with deep rail engineering knowledge strong industry networks and a proven ability to position and win complex digital survey and geospatial work packages for major capital programmes.

This is a high-impact role requiring thought leadership stakeholder engagement and commercial acumen. The successful candidate will support Murphy Geospatials growth on upcoming rail projects in Ireland including opportunities aligned to the All Island Strategic Rail Plan and Transport Infrastructure Irelands delivery of MetroLink and Luas projects throughout the country.


What You Will Do


Strategic Business Development & Account Growth

  • Lead and grow strategic accounts within the rail sector across Ireland with a particular focus on the upcoming Metrolink project.
  • Develop account plans to expand Murphy Geospatials digital and geospatial service offerings leveraging Woolperts wider international expertise where relevant.
  • Identify and shape opportunities for large digital survey geospatial monitoring and engineering support work packages within major rail and transit programmes.
  • Support Murphy Geospatials positioning on projects associated with the All Island Strategic Rail Plan MetroLink Luas expansion rail upgrades station developments depots and related transport infrastructure.
  • Work closely with bid technical and delivery teams to support winning proposals framework positions and long-term account growth.

Client & Stakeholder Engagement

  • Build and maintain senior-level relationships across rail clients transport authorities engineering consultants Tier 1 contractors and their supply chains.
  • Map account organisations to identify key stakeholders decision-makers influencers and procurement leads.
  • Understand customer challenges project drivers delivery constraints and commercial objectives and align Murphy Geospatials value proposition accordingly.
  • Translate complex technical solutions into clear ROI narratives for procurement commercial and bid evaluation teams.
  • Represent the clients strategic objectives internally ensuring high-quality delivery and long-term partnership development.
  • Act as a trusted advisor on the use of geospatial BIM digital twin and monitoring methodologies to support planning design construction and operational decision-making.

Industry Leadership & Advocacy

  • Represent Murphy Geospatial at rail industry forums conferences and working groups to strengthen brand visibility and sector credibility.
  • Participate in panel discussions webinars or technical committees to establish Murphy Geospatial as a trusted digital and geospatial partner in the rail sector.
  • Support the development of thought leadership CPD sessions client workshops and account-based marketing initiatives relevant to rail infrastructure.
  • Maintain awareness of competitor activity market trends procurement pipelines and investment priorities within the Irish rail sector.

Commercial & Internal Collaboration

  • Oversee strategic commercial opportunities within assigned accounts supporting sound margin risk and growth outcomes.
  • Maintain a robust pipeline of opportunities through CRM with clear reporting on account activity opportunity status and revenue potential.
  • Coordinate internal subject matter experts to develop compelling proposals and ensure Murphy Geospatial presents a joined-up high-value offer to rail clients.
  • Act as a point of reference internally and externally for resolving and escalating customer issues.


What You Will Bring


  • 10 years of experience in the rail sector with strong rail engineering-specific experience.
  • Proven track record of winning bids or shaping work packages for large rail or transit capital programmes.
  • Comfortable with client-side stakeholder management and translating technical value propositions into business cases.
  • Experience with major infrastructure projects such as heavy rail light rail metro station development route upgrades or transport corridor improvements.
  • Strong understanding of rail project lifecycles across planning design construction commissioning and operation.
  • Knowledge of BIM Digital Twin Geospatial and survey technologies.
  • Established professional network within the Irish rail sector is highly desirable.
